For her first institutional solo exhibition, Ju Young Kim has transformed the Kunsthalle Mannheim’s STUDIO space into an Incognito Apartment, where familiar objects from the domestic sphere meet components from the industrial context — in this case repurposed airplane parts. The exhibition is curated by Dorothea Lorenz.
Ju Young Kim (*1991, Seoul, KR) explores transitional states and transit zones in her sculptures and installations by combining industrial transportation modules from airplanes and cars into symbolically encoded works. She blends these with stained glass, cast metal, ceramics and plastic, thus bringing together high-tech objects with hand crafts techniques. The works are characterized by surreal elements that have been extracted from their original context and open up a new perspective on the phenomena of the globalized world.
